# Make Data Count
[Make Data Count](https://makedatacount.org) is an initiative that promotes open data metrics to enable the evaluation and reward of research data reuse and impact. Technical development for Make Data Count infrastructure is supported by [DataCite](https://datacite.org).

This repository is for community feedback about Make Data Count infrastructure. At this stage, we are primarily interested in collecting feedback on the [Data Citation Corpus](https://makedatacount.org/data-citation/). Feedback will be reviewed and prioritized by the Make Data Count and DataCite teams.
